I have a dilema and need some opinions from you guys to make up my mind Confused

I have an 08 Patriot Blue Reg Cab, but Ive gone ahead and put the Thunder Road badging normally found on Quad Cabs on it. I think it looks cool, and adds a little bit of personality to the truck.

Anyway, the cool people down at tintartsigns.com will make me a custom THUNDER ROAD bed side decal identical to the NIGHT RUNNER decals they sell. Im thinkin a matte or glossy black outline with glossy silver letters.

Just wondering what ya'll thought about the idea both with getting the decal, and the color choices im thinkin about. Thanks in advance!

I would leave it the way it is. Its a very nice truck but anyone who knows will know its not a real Thunder Road. If you wanted it to look more like a regular cab Thunder Road tribute I would start by adding the correct 20" x 9.0" Aluminum wheels. You can usally find them on Ebay for a fair price. You might also want to think about correcting the placement of the badges you put on your doors. The T in Thunder Road does not go past the R in Ram on the drivers side, and the D should not go past the M on the passengers side. Also if you dont have the fog light option thats another dead give away. I would just be proud of what it is, a nice clean Dodge truck. If you would like to see what a real Patriot blue Thunder Road should look like I will send you some pics of mine.
